
With the onset of winter in Delhi-NCR, the level of air pollution has also increased rapidly. The level of the Air Quality Index has fallen drastically in NCR cities including Delhi, Ghaziabad, Noida, Gurugram, and Faridabad. Due to this people are facing health-related problems and there are also a large number of people who have to be admitted to hospitals. Dr. Arvind Kumar, Chairman, of the Chest Surgery Institute of Medanta Hospital has also confirmed this. He said that people's eyes are burning due to poor air quality index. The eyes are turning red and water is often flowing. Apart from this, there is a burning sensation in the nose and the lips are also getting affected.
He said the air quality index is poor and the level of smoke in the air has increased. Dr. Arvind Kumar said that the smoke is going into the chest, due to which people are facing the problem of a burning sensation. People are also having problems with the lungs. Apart from this, the throat of people is also getting worse. If you touch your tongue, you will feel a strange test there too. He said that this polluted air reaches the blood through the lungs and then it reaches from the head to the soles. We can say that every part of the body is being affected by this pollution.
Not only this, the doctor of Medanta said that in the last few days, the number of people admitted to the hospital due to pollution has also increased rapidly. He said that people are getting admitted to ICU here after suffering from chest infections and pneumonia. This is proof of how the level of pollution is increasing rapidly. There has been a rapid increase in the number of people admitted to the ICU after suffering from chest infections and pneumonia. He said that this is also affecting the brain and there is a risk of children becoming irritable. At the same time, due to this pollution in elderly people, the risk of stroke can increase up to 10 times.
